Presentation given by Diarmuid Stokes, College Liaison Librarian at University College Dublin Library, Dublin, Ireland, at the Great Expectations Conference, Birmingham City University, UK, December 5, 2014.

Outcomes for the Library

•No more bean counting

•Closed Data collection Cycle

•Collaborating with other units

•Using information to improve services, teaching and communication

•No cost implications

•No IT issues

•Improving support across campus for students
